2/2007The influence of hormone replacement therapy on cardiovascular disease

ZYGMUNT ZDROJEWICZ (Katedra i Klinika Endokrynologii, Diabetologii i Leczenia Izotopami Akademii Medycznej we Wrocławiu;Kierownik: prof. dr hab. med. Andrzej Milewicz )

Summary
Nowadays, there are fewer indications for hormone replacement therapy (HTZ), as consequences of results from the large interventional trial. On the ground on such results HTZ are not recommended in primary and secondary prevention of coronary heart disease. Moreover HTZ can increase incidence of cerebral insults and breast cancers. On the other hand, in many clinical and experimental investigations was found out that such therapy may be beneficial by its influence on atherosclerosis risk factor, especially on coagulant and fibrinolytic proteins, and inflammatory markers. HTZ can not only reduce level of these factors but also improve endothelial function and for that reason may be used in fight with atherosclerosis. In our work we presented also contemporary indications for using hormone replacement therapy in postmenopausal women.
